RX.net 主题线程对于订阅者来说安全吗?

问题描述 投票:0回答:1

我很难找到信息,因为谷歌给出了有关同时将数据推送到主题的安全性的结果,这不是我的用例,我有一个专用线程(运行无限循环)生成数据,我想要N 个其他线程能够订阅它。

  1. 如果我只从单个线程(也恰好是实例创建)线程?

  2. 在这种情况下它是安全的:是否在任何时候都安全(当主线程处于调用 OnNext 的中间时,我可以从另一个线程订阅)还是只有当我调用 Subscribe 时没有生成数据时才安全?

  3. 与 #2 相同的问题,但是关于多个观察者同时调用 Subscribe 来注册,如果我有十几个线程需要注册,这也安全吗?

c# .net system.reactive
1个回答
0
投票

@Enigmativity 在评论中确认订阅是线程安全的。

如果有人提供更详细/官方的资料,我会接受任何答案,而不是这个答案。

© www.soinside.com 2019 - 2024. All rights reserved.